Clinton, Oklahoma, embodies a welcoming small-town atmosphere, rich with cultural diversity and community spirit. Residents enjoy affordable housing and a variety of local amenities, which enhance their quality of life. However, economic challenges, including a recent decline in employment opportunities, have contributed to increased stress and mental health concerns among the population. Access to healthcare services can be limited, impacting overall wellness in the community. These social and economic dynamics highlight the importance of addressing mental health challenges that many residents face, including anxiety and depression related to financial strain. Fortunately, Clinton offers a range of mental health resources, providing essential support for individuals of all ages. From crisis intervention to case management, these services can profoundly impact the well-being of those in need. It varies by listing. Food pantries, many housing programs and faith-based services are typically free, while therapists and treatment centers usually charge or bill insurance. Check the individual listing and contact the provider directly to confirm.
No. The providers and organizations listed here are independent of 7 Cups - we do not employ them and cannot vouch for them. What 7 Cups does offer directly is free emotional support from trained volunteer listeners, and online therapy with licensed professionals.
If you are in immediate danger, call 988 in the US or go to your nearest emergency room. For someone to talk to straight away, you can chat with a trained volunteer listener at any hour, free.
